About thirty years ago, these instruments were used to study several thousands of blood samples of unselected donors thus defining the reference interval of platelet count as 150450 or 150400109/L.4,5 These values are still used today in most Western countries, although in the meantime several studies have indicated that platelet count varies according to age, sex and ethnicity. Sex-related differences in platelet count were described for the first time in 1977 in a study that analyzed 868 blood donors.
